Texas Senate Bill SB2463 Compare Versions

OldNewDifferences
11 88R7233 MLH-D
22 By: Hall S.B. No. 2463
33
44
55 A BILL TO BE ENTITLED
66 AN ACT
77 relating to the procedure for early voting.
88 B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S:
99 SECTION 1. Section 61.002(c), Election Code, is amended to
1010 read as follows:
1111 (c) Immediately after closing the polls for voting on
1212 election day and on the last day of early voting by personal
1313 appearance, the presiding election judge or alternate election
1414 judge shall print the tape to show the number of votes cast for each
1515 candidate or ballot measure for each voting machine.
1616 SECTION 2. Sections 85.001(a) and (c), Election Code, are
1717 amended to read as follows:
1818 (a) The period for early voting by personal appearance
1919 begins on the eighth [17th] day before election day and continues
2020 through the [fourth] day before election day, except as otherwise
2121 provided by this section.
2222 (c) If the date prescribed by Subsection (a) [or (b)] for
2323 beginning the period is a Saturday, Sunday, or legal state holiday,
2424 the early voting period begins on the next regular business day.
2525 SECTION 3. Section 85.033, Election Code, is amended to
2626 read as follows:
2727 Sec. 85.033. SECURITY OF VOTING MACHINE. (a) At the close
2828 of early voting each day, the early voting clerk shall secure each
2929 voting machine used for early voting in the manner prescribed by the
3030 secretary of state so that its unauthorized operation is prevented.
3131 The clerk shall unsecure the machine before the beginning of early
3232 voting the following day.
3333 (b) To the extent possible, closing and securing of voting
3434 machines shall be done in the same manner as required by provisions
3535 of this code pertaining to election day.
3636 SECTION 4. Sections 85.001(b) and (e), Election Code, are
3737 repealed.
3838 SECTION 5. This Act takes effect September 1, 2023.
